News Providers’ Council getting off to fast start with new year

The new year is underway and the Council back at work for our members across the Commonwealth.

In Boston, legislators of the 191st Massachusetts General Court were to be officially sworn in beginning at 11 a.m. Wednesday, Jan. 2, kicking off a two-year session during which the Council will pursue our Pro-Workforce Legislative Agenda, including fair pay for comparable work, the creation of a student loan repayment program, as well as exploring two new bills addressing health insurance options and an EMAC Supplement exemption for nonprofits. The full agenda, fact sheets and bill text will be available in late January.
